Vietnamese Body Parts — Essential Vocabulary

Body part vocabulary is essential for healthcare situations, visiting a doctor or pharmacy in Vietnam, describing pain or injury, and understanding everyday expressions. Many Vietnamese idioms and proverbs reference specific body parts metaphorically — knowing the vocabulary unlocks a deeper layer of the language.


Head and Face — Đầu và Mặt

đầudowhead
tóctokhair
mặtmahtface (also: dignity, honour in social contexts)
mắtmahteye(s)
taitaiear(s)
mũimooinose
miệngmyengmouth
răngrangteeth / tooth
lưỡiluoitongue
môimoilip(s)
cằmgamchin
mahcheek (same word as Southern "mother" — different tone!)
trántranforehead
cổgohneck / throat

Body — Thân Thể

vaivaishoulder(s)
cánh taygang tayarm
bàn tayban tayhand
ngón tayngon tayfinger(s)
ngựcngukchest
bụngbungstomach / belly
lưnglungback
chânchunleg / foot
đầu gốidow goiknee
bàn chânban chunfoot
ngón chânngon chuntoe(s)

Describing Pain and Health Problems

The pattern "bị đau + body part" covers most pain situations a traveller might need to describe:

Tôi bị đau đầutoy bee dow dowI have a headache
Tôi bị đau bụngtoy bee dow bungI have a stomachache
Tôi bị đau răngtoy bee dow rangI have a toothache
Tôi bị đau lưngtoy bee dow lungI have a backache
Tôi bị đau họngtoy bee dow hongI have a sore throat
Cơ thể tôi...guh theh toyMy body... (start of describing symptoms)
